Koeman Strikes Back at Ghaly!

Date: 20-12-2005
Wrote: EP's editor Islam Issa

Feyenoord's head coach Erwin Koeman openly criticised Hossam Ghaly in the post-game press conference, once more hinting that it may be the end of the midfielder's career at the Rotterdam club.

Feyenoord's championship hopes took a small blow as they failed to register points against strugglers ADO Den Haag, allowing PSV and AZ to race three points ahead in the league standings.

Ghaly was substituted for a 17-year-old after less than an hour in the last game, and the Dutch press subsequently wrote that he was one of the poorer performers on the pitch.

"It is time he (Ghaly) begins to understand what it is all about," said Koeman in the press conference.

He added, "I doubt whether Ghaly will ever really understand."


Just three days ago Hossam stressed to EgyptianPlayers.com that he is happy with his current situation! "I had a nice talk with the gaffer (Koeman) and I should stress that he was very understanding." He also added, "Now I can’t be happier with how things are going for me at the club." A month ago he had said to EP, "They talk about the intercepted ball I made but ignore all my positives."

Is it destiny that Feyenoord and Ghaly must separate? Sooner or later we will find out...
